HR 423: Emergency Pension Plan Relief Act of 2021

Emergency Pension Plan Relief Act of 2021 This bill modifies the funding rules and provides financial assistance for certain pension plans that are underfunded or insolvent. First, the bill expands the authority of, and provides funding for, the Pension Benefit Guaranty Corporation (PBGC) to provide special partition assistance to a multiemployer pension plan that is insolvent or at risk of insolvency. The bill expands eligibility for partition assistance, provides funding for a plan to reach a projected funded ratio of 80% over a 30-year period, and does not require a plan to repay such assistance. The bill further permits a multiemployer pension plan to elect to retain its funding zone status from the previous year for either (1) the first plan year beginning during the period from March 1, 2020, through February 28, 2021; or (2) the next succeeding plan year, as designated by the plan sponsor. A plan may also extend by five years the funding improvement or rehabilitation period if the plan is designated as in endangered or critical status for a plan year beginning in 2020 or 2021. A plan in critical and declining status may not suspend payment of plan benefits. Additionally, the bill adjusts the minimum funding standards for a multiemployer pension plan to account for investment losses and other losses related to the COVID-19 (i.e., coronavirus disease 2019) pandemic and modifies the PBGC guarantee formula to increase the maximum potential benefits under a multiemployer pension plan. Finally, the bill makes changes with respect to single employer pension plans, including revising the amortization rules and extending and modifying the pension funding stabilization percentages.

HR 384: Bicycle Commuter Act of 2021

Bicycle Commuter Act of 2021 This bill modifies provisions relating to the tax exclusion for employer-provided fringe benefits for bicycle commuting. Specifically, the bill (1) repeals the suspension (for the period between 2018 and the end of 2025) of the exclusion, (2) includes bikeshare (a bicycle rental operation providing for pick up and drop off) and low-speed electric bicycle within the definition of bicycle for purposes of the exclusion, and (3) modifies the limitation on the exclusion to provide for a specified monthly limitation amount (i.e., 30% of the parking fringe benefit amount).

HR 393: Federal Firefighter Pay Equity Act

Federal Firefighter Pay Equity Act This bill modifies certain pay calculations that are used to determine retirement and annuity benefits for federal firefighters. Specifically, the bill adjusts the method of determining the average pay of a federal firefighter by adding one-half of a firefighter's basic hourly rate multiplied by the number of overtime hours included as part of such firefighter's regular tour of duty.

HR 392: FAIR Act

Federal Adjustment of Income Rates Act or the FAIR Act This bill modifies pay rates for federal employees in 2022. Specifically, the bill increases rates under the statutory pay systems and for prevailing rate employees by 2.2%, and increases locality pay by 1%.

HR 400: Civics Learning Act of 2021

Civics Learning Act of 2021 This bill expands the use of American History and Civics Education—National Activities grants to prioritize innovative civics learning and teaching. Specifically, the bill expands the allowable uses of these grants to include before-, during-, and after-school activities and extracurricular activities; activities that include service learning and community service projects that are linked to school curriculum; activities that encourage and support student participation in school governance; and online and video game-based learning. Further, the Department of Education must ensure that specified percentages of grant funds are awarded on a diverse basis to eligible entities (e.g., institutions of higher education) that serve students and teachers at elementary schools, middle schools, and high schools.

HR 403: To repeal a restriction on the use of funds by the Securities and Exchange Commission to ensure shareholders of corporations have knowledge of corporate political activity.

This bill repeals the prohibition on the use of certain funds by the Securities and Exchange Commission to implement a rule, regulation, or order to require the disclosure of political contributions, contributions to tax exempt organizations, or dues paid to trade associations.

HR 373: To treat certain face coverings and disinfectants as medical expenses for purposes of certain Federal tax benefits.

This bill allows a medical expense tax deduction for face masks and hand sanitizers during the period of the COVID-19 (i.e., coronavirus disease 2019) public health emergency beginning on the enactment of this bill and ending when the COVID-19 emergency period has terminated.

SRES 5: A resolution honoring the memory of Officer Brian David Sicknick of the United States Capitol Police for his selfless acts of heroism on the grounds of the United States Capitol on January 6, 2021.

This resolution honors the memory of U.S. Capitol Police Officer Brian D. Sicknick for sacrificing his life in the line of duty on January 6, 2021, and it calls for justice to be brought to those responsible for the attack on the Capitol and the death of Officer Sicknick.

HR 347: Presidential Tax Transparency Act

Presidential Tax Transparency Act This bill requires the President, the Vice President, and certain candidates for President and Vice President to disclose federal income tax returns for the ten most recent taxable years. The returns must be disclosed to the Federal Election Commission (FEC), which must make the returns publicly available after redacting information that is necessary for protecting against identity theft, such as Social Security numbers. If the tax returns are not disclosed to the FEC as required by this bill, the Internal Revenue Service must provide the returns to the FEC upon receiving a written request from the FEC.

HJRES 16: Providing for congressional disapproval of the proposed transfer to the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land, the Kingdom of Spain, and the Italian Republic of certain defense articles and services.

This joint resolution prohibits the issuance of a manufacturing license, technical assistance license, or export license with respect to certain proposed agreements or transfers of specified defense articles or services to Saudi Arabia, the United Kingdom, Spain, or Italy.
